Unveiling The Enigmatic Albino Boa Constrictor: Discoveries And Insights

An albino boa constrictor is a non-venomous snake belonging to the Boidae family. It is an impressive creature characterized by its large size, vibrant patterns, and striking coloration. Due to a genetic mutation, albino boa constrictors lack the usual dark pigments found in their wild counterparts, resulting in a predominantly white or cream-colored appearance with distinctive reddish-pink eyes.

These snakes are native to tropical regions of Central and South America, where they inhabit diverse ecosystems, including rainforests, grasslands, and savannas. Known for their exceptional hunting abilities, boa constrictors are ambush predators that primarily feed on small mammals, birds, and occasionally larger prey. Their unique hunting technique involves coiling around their victim and suffocating it.

In captivity, albino boa constrictors are popular among reptile enthusiasts due to their docile nature and striking appearance. They require specialized care to thrive, including appropriate housing, temperature gradients, and a steady supply of live prey. Responsible ownership and proper husbandry practices are essential for ensuring the well-being of these magnificent creatures.

Genetic Mutation

Albinism is a genetic mutation that affects the production of melanin, the pigment responsible for coloration in animals. In albino boa constrictors, this mutation results in a lack of dark pigments, leading to their distinctive white or cream coloration and reddish-pink eyes.

  • Reduced Camouflage: The lack of dark pigments affects the snake's ability to camouflage itself in its natural environment. This reduced camouflage may make albino boa constrictors more vulnerable to predators.
  • Unique Appearance: The albino boa constrictor's striking appearance sets it apart from its wild-type counterparts. This unique coloration makes it a sought-after species among reptile enthusiasts and collectors.
  • Genetic Diversity: Albinism, while a genetic variation, contributes to the genetic diversity of boa constrictor populations. Genetic diversity is crucial for the long-term survival and adaptability of a species.
  • Selective Breeding: In captivity, albino boa constrictors are selectively bred to enhance and perpetuate their unique coloration. This selective breeding has led to the development of various albino morphs with distinct patterns and shades.

The genetic mutation that results in albinism significantly impacts the appearance and characteristics of boa constrictors. It affects their camouflage abilities, contributes to their unique coloration, and plays a role in genetic diversity and selective breeding practices.

Question 1: Are albino boa constrictors dangerous to humans?

Albino boa constrictors, like their wild-type counterparts, are generally not considered dangerous to humans. They are non-venomous and do not possess an aggressive nature. However, it's important to approach all snakes with caution and respect, avoiding sudden movements or handling them without proper training.

Question 2: What is the lifespan of an albino boa constrictor?

In captivity, with proper care and nutrition, albino boa constrictors can live for an average of 20 to 30 years. Factors such as genetics, diet, and overall health can influence their lifespan.

Question 3: Can albino boa constrictors breed with wild-type boa constrictors?

Yes, albino boa constrictors can successfully breed with wild-type boa constrictors. The offspring may exhibit a range of colorations, including albino, wild-type, and various other genetic variations.

Question 4: Are albino boa constrictors more sensitive to light than wild-type boa constrictors?

While albino boa constrictors have reduced melanin production, they are not necessarily more sensitive to light compared to wild-type boa constrictors. However, as with all snakes, they should be provided with appropriate hiding places and protection from excessive sunlight.

Question 5: What is the ideal habitat for an albino boa constrictor?

Albino boa constrictors require a secure and spacious enclosure that mimics their natural habitat. This includes providing a temperature gradient, adequate hiding spots, a water source, and appropriate substrate.

Tips for Caring for Albino Boa Constrictors

Providing proper care for albino boa constrictors is essential for their well-being and longevity in captivity. Here are some crucial tips to follow:

Tip 1: Provide an Appropriate Enclosure

Albino boa constrictors require a secure and spacious enclosure that mimics their natural habitat. The enclosure should be escape-proof, well-ventilated, and provide a temperature gradient ranging from 75 to 85 degrees Fahrenheit (24 to 29 degrees Celsius). Adequate hiding spots and a water source should also be included.

Tip 2: Offer a Proper Diet

Albino boa constrictors are obligate carnivores and primarily feed on rodents. A varied diet of appropriately sized prey is essential for their health and well-being. Live or frozen-thawed rodents are commonly offered to these snakes in captivity.

Tip 3: Maintain Proper Humidity

Albino boa constrictors require moderate humidity levels ranging from 50 to 60%. Providing a humid hide box or regularly misting the enclosure can help maintain the necessary humidity levels.

Tip 4: Handle with Care

When handling an albino boa constrictor, always approach calmly and avoid sudden movements. Support the snake's body fully and never handle it if it is shedding or displaying defensive behavior.

Tip 5: Provide Regular Veterinary Care

Regular veterinary check-ups are crucial for monitoring the health of albino boa constrictors. A qualified veterinarian can provide guidance on proper care, nutrition, and any necessary medical treatments.
